Property Description for 5000 Goodridge Ave

Located on a beautiful tree -lined Street in the heart of Fieldston this 7 bedroom ,6.5 bathrooms English Country Style house has magnificent scale & grandeur.

Built in 1923 on a corner lot this home has been renovated and its period details have been carefully restored & preserved & adding every modern convenience.

The graciously proportioned Living Room includes a wood -burning fireplace, wainscoting, a decorative ceiling & oak floors. The Living Room is flanked by a beautiful den with custom built- ins & an inviting sun room is on the other side.

On the opposite side of the entrance gallery is an elegant formal dining room. A meticulously renovated kitchen is a cook's delight. No detail spared with double sub zero refrigerators & freezers, double dishwashers & double ovens. In addition there is a wood-topped center island, granite counters, large walk-in pantry & a desk area.

Two maid's rooms are currently being used as offices & there are one & half baths. The second floor has a sprawling, sumptuous master bedroom with exquisite light, terrace, wood -burning fireplace, his & hers bathroom & huge closets. There are 3 additional spacious bedrooms & two bathrooms. Not to be missed is the beautiful skylight over the staircase. The full size attic can be additional four bedrooms. The recreation room in the basement boasts a professional gym designed by gym source. An additional guest room, full bath complete the space.

The home is equipped with a multi -zone HVAC system & a central vacuum system.Outdoor gardens are lush with flowers & has magnificent trees make sitting on the patio like being in an oasis.This home is located near private schools & houses of worship. Riverdale | Bronx

Quick Profile

Searching for a little bit of country that can be your home base, while still being able to take advantage of everything that NYC offers? Do you want a slower pace of living, focused on family and the great outdoors? Riverdale may be your perfect choice. Only about ten miles north of Midtown, Riverdale’s bucolic paradise feels like you have left the city entirely. You would never guess that you are still within the confines of the Bronx. 

Riverdale is primarily residential with a substantial number of single-family homes and corridors of high-rise apartments. There are many large parks, and they play a major role in the lives of the residents, as they are a primary source of entertainment. Clean, safe streets make Riverdale a great place to walk or cycle. There are trees everywhere, and the air is fresh and invigorating. It is a great place to raise a family, but more and more singles and young professionals are moving into Riverdale, in search of larger, less expensive apartments, and to enjoy the parks and the remarkable views of the Hudson River and Manhattan.  

While the grid layout of the rest of the city makes it easy to find your way from here to there, Riverdale chose to forego that structure, choosing instead to let the verdant streets twist and wind their way around natural obstacles in designs by Frederick Law Olmsted, of Central Park fame. Some streets are divided, with traffic in one direction being at an entirely different level than traffic headed the opposite way on the same street. This quirkiness adds a certain charm to this neighborhood.
